I can recall as many of you may remember growing up in a single family household. However, my mother had ten children to care and provide for. My mother worked two and sometimes three jobs to ensure that we had shelter, food and other essentials. Our environment wasn’t the best given the era during those times but it wasn’t considered to be bad either.

Although my mother instilled great values to my siblings and myself, I developed bad habits in my way of thinking. For instance, a lot of my peers at the time had this idea that they weren’t going to work. If I wanted to be accepted by them then I needed to conform to this way of thinking which I did for years. There were those in the community that had different views about work and those were the people that did better and had more than those that thought like us. I recall sitting on one of the corners that the my crew and I frequented and begin to question why was my world flipping upside down. That was when I decided to change my way of thinking for good. Another thing that I learned from this experience is that my mother understood the importance of having various streams of income to provide for her family, that’s why she was willing to work so many jobs.

While following the negative thinking of others and not doing as my mother taught us I realized a lot of time was wasted on things that had no meaning. The one thing that all humans have in common is time. Depending on how we spend our time will determine our destiny and the future of our families.
